Output 3d80499838d54a3d8fea5eee457670b410e9bad44892f77a166f7cb5059f0f25:28

value
5098507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f40ad15aa0e84e771cb6d3e1c20dd8d636e054 OP_EQUAL
address
3Mk2FucR63gAZcdxpDsWYsjJ6p8PYfXKJh
transaction
3d80499838d54a3d8fea5eee457670b410e9bad44892f77a166f7cb5059f0f25
spent
true